My car is A Subaru WRX 2004 Non USDM

This is where i'm at, using ecuexplorer i can connect to the car and am able to reset ecu.
I want to download rom image to my Laptop

I connect the green plugs and jumper the block

I can start process for downloading rom image to my laptop, it comes up with file save as, so i enter a file name (by the way does it make any difference what the file is called?) then click save. It then tries to access ecu but comes up with the following below:

ecuFlash [20/01/08 @ 21:01:00]
1452 byte kernel read.
kernel checksum is valid (n = 2).
kernel image loaded and verified.
denso02_bootloader_cmd_start
denso02_bootloader_cmd_start
denso02_bootloader_cmd_start
denso02_bootloader_cmd_start
denso02_bootloader_cmd_start
kernel flash disable
rkrv: preamble 1 no response
process complete

but it saves no file????????????????????

can anyone help
do i need to change to alternative settings in the default.
can you also tell me should the green plugs stay connected when driving??????????????
by the way i have tried using other ecuflash software and it doesn't even connect to the car.

Hi
when you enter the save name make sure you put .hex afterthe name ie

mysti.hex

then click save.

If that doesn't work try using ECU Flash program

Run program click on "Read from Ecu" then you will see a box asking which vehicle you have click on the one you have then continue

It will say something like connect green connector and flash block connector then turn on your ignition then click go straight away.

Try that and good luck
